Web10 de fev. de 2024 · The standard temperature in aviation is measured at the mean sea level (msl) pressure of 29.92 inches of mercury (Hg) and is 15° C or 59° F. The standard temperature decreases 2 °C or 3.5 °F ... Web4 de set. de 2024 · An increase in density altitude adversely affects your aircraft’s performance by increasing takeoff distance, reducing rate of climb, increasing true air speed on approach, landing and increasing landing roll distance. In addition, high density altitude decreases the engine’s horsepower output. In normally aspirated engines, power and … truey shirt https://grupo-vg.com

Program is asking for … Web1 de out. de 2024 · Density altitude is pressure altitude corrected for non-standard temperature. When it's hot outside, your airplane doesn't perform as well. Your takeoff distance is longer, and you don't climb as fast. That's because when it's hot, density altitude increases, and your airplane "feels" like it's flying at a higher altitude. Since a pro philip hardwickWebFor 5,000 feet density altitude and above, or high ambient temperatures, roughness or reduction of power may occur at full rich mixture. The mixture may be adjusted to obtain smooth engine operation. For fixed-pitch propellers, lean to maximum RPM at full throttle prior to takeoff where airports are at 5,000-feet density altitude or higher. philip harman dac beachcroft
